SBD/Issue 135/Sponsorships, Advertising & Marketing
Marketplace Round-Up
Published April 4, 2008
The BUSINESS COURIER OF CINCINNATI reported DHL has added the Reds to its list of MLB sponsorships, becoming the club's "official express delivery and logistics provider" through the 2010 season. The deal includes in-stadium signage in team bullpens, "first ball delivery" before each home game, presenting sponsorship of the July 17-20 Mets-Reds series and sponsorship of the Redsfest event. DHL in return will receive "in-stadium hospitality and a discount ticket program for its employees" (BIZJOURNALS.com, 4/2).
WHEELS & DEALS: NASCAR fan Ron Bernheim's face will appear on the Gillett Evernham Motorspots No. 9 Dodge driven by Kasey Kahne during Saturday's Nationwide Series O'Reilly 300 at Texas Motor Speedway, the prize for winning the online "Your Face in the Race" contest (FT. WORTH STAR-TELEGRAM, 4/3)....The Jimmie Johnson Foundation will be the title sponsor for the NASCAR Camping World Series race at Phoenix Int'l Raceway. The Jimmie Johnson Foundation 150 will run April 10 at 10:15pm ET during the Sprint Cup and Nationwide Series weekend at Phoenix (SCENEDAILY.com, 4/2).
NOTES: The AVP Crocs Tour has signed a five-year contract extension with Wilson as the tour's official game ball. The deal extends through the 2012 season of the AVP Crocs Tour and gives Wilson and its products a significant on-site presence (AVP)....Rockies LF Matt Holliday has "agreed to serve as an advertising" spokesperson for Denver-based Qwest Communications Int'l, and to "take part in a pay-for-play charity program" for the company (BIZJOURNALS.com, 4/2)....Hawks F Al Horford appeared on ESPN’s "Jim Rome Is Burning" and said the team has "kind of been working on" a Web site promoting his Rookie of the Year candidacy. Rome: "If I were you, I’d call it AlForROY.com” (“Jim Rome Is Burning,” ESPN, 4/3).
